The advent of large language models like ChatGPT has opened up exciting new possibilities for creatives, especially in the realm of screenplay writing. While it's crucial to understand that ChatGPT is a tool and not a replacement for human creativity, when used effectively, it can significantly enhance and accelerate the screenwriting process. This guide explores various ways to leverage ChatGPT for screenplay writing, covering everything from brainstorming to polishing your final draft.

I. Understanding ChatGPT's Capabilities and Limitations

Before diving into practical applications, it's essential to understand what ChatGPT can and cannot do:

A. Capabilities

  • Idea Generation: ChatGPT excels at generating ideas for plots, characters, settings, and themes.
  • Brainstorming: It can help explore different angles and possibilities within your screenplay.
  • Character Development: ChatGPT can assist in fleshing out character backstories, motivations, and relationships.
  • Plot Outline Creation: It can help structure your story into acts, sequences, and scenes.
  • Dialogue Generation: While often needing refinement, ChatGPT can generate dialogue that reflects different character voices and tones.
  • Scene Description: It can create vivid descriptions of settings and actions.
  • World-Building: For genres like fantasy and science fiction, ChatGPT can aid in constructing believable and consistent worlds.
  • Research: It can quickly gather information on specific topics relevant to your screenplay.
  • Rewriting and Editing: ChatGPT can help identify areas for improvement and suggest alternative phrasing.

B. Limitations

  • Lack of True Creativity: ChatGPT is trained on existing data and can only recombine elements it has learned. It cannot create truly original ideas in the same way a human can.
  • Inconsistency and Inaccuracy: ChatGPT can sometimes produce inconsistent or factually incorrect information. Always verify its output.
  • Predictable Dialogue: Without careful prompting and editing, ChatGPT-generated dialogue can sound generic and lack nuance.
  • Inability to Grasp Subtlety and Emotion: Conveying complex emotions and subtle nuances requires a human touch that ChatGPT often struggles with.
  • Ethical Concerns: Ensure you are not plagiarizing or violating copyright when using ChatGPT. Always attribute its contributions appropriately.
  • Dependence and Over-Reliance: Relying too heavily on ChatGPT can stifle your own creativity and lead to a derivative screenplay.

II. Using ChatGPT for Different Stages of Screenplay Writing

ChatGPT can be integrated into various stages of the screenwriting process:

A. Brainstorming and Idea Generation

This is where ChatGPT truly shines. It can help overcome writer's block and spark new ideas.

  1. Generating Loglines:

    Prompt: "Generate 10 loglines for a science fiction thriller about a detective who discovers a conspiracy involving artificial intelligence."

    Review the loglines generated by ChatGPT and choose the one that resonates most with you. Then, refine it and use it as a starting point for your screenplay.

  2. Exploring Themes:

    Prompt: "What are some themes that could be explored in a screenplay about climate change?"

    ChatGPT can provide a list of potential themes, such as environmental responsibility, corporate greed, government inaction, and the power of individual action.

  3. Creating Character Concepts:

    Prompt: "Describe a flawed but sympathetic character who is addicted to gambling."

    ChatGPT might generate a description of a character with a specific backstory, motivations, and flaws, which you can then develop further.

  4. Developing Settings:

    Prompt: "Describe a dystopian city in the year 2077."

    This can help you visualize and create a unique and compelling setting for your story.

  5. "What If" Scenarios:

    Prompt: "What if a small town discovered they were living inside a simulation?"

    Exploring these scenarios can lead to unexpected plot twists and intriguing conflicts.

B. Character Development

Building believable and compelling characters is crucial for a successful screenplay. ChatGPT can assist in this process.

  1. Generating Backstories:

    Prompt: "Create a backstory for a character who is a former spy haunted by a past mission."

    Specify details about the character's age, gender, skills, and the nature of the past mission to get more specific results.

  2. Defining Motivations:

    Prompt: "What are the possible motivations for a character who betrays their best friend?"

    ChatGPT can provide a range of motivations, such as greed, jealousy, fear, or a desire for revenge.

  3. Exploring Relationships:

    Prompt: "How would a character who is emotionally closed off interact with a character who is very empathetic?"

    This can help you understand the dynamics between your characters and create more realistic and engaging interactions.

  4. Creating Character Arcs:

    Prompt: "Outline a character arc for a protagonist who starts as a selfish individual but learns to be selfless."

    ChatGPT can help you map out the character's journey, including key turning points and challenges they face.

  5. Generating Dialogue Based on Character:

    Prompt: "Write a short monologue for a cynical detective who is being forced to work with a rookie partner. The monologue should demonstrate their cynicism and weariness."

    This can provide examples of how the character would speak and think.

C. Plot Development and Story Structure

Structuring your screenplay effectively is essential for maintaining audience engagement. ChatGPT can assist in outlining your plot and structuring your story.

  1. Creating Act Outlines:

    Prompt: "Outline the three acts of a screenplay about a young woman who discovers she has superpowers."

    ChatGPT can provide a basic structure for each act, including the inciting incident, rising action, climax, and resolution.

  2. Generating Scene Ideas:

    Prompt: "Suggest 5 scenes that could occur in the first act of a romantic comedy about two rivals who are forced to work together."

    This can help you brainstorm specific scenes that advance the plot and develop the characters.

  3. Developing Plot Twists:

    Prompt: "Suggest some plot twists that could occur in a mystery thriller about a missing person."

    ChatGPT can provide unexpected twists that keep the audience guessing.

  4. Exploring Different Endings:

    Prompt: "Suggest three different endings for a screenplay about a group of friends who go on a camping trip that turns into a survival situation."

    This can help you consider different possibilities for the climax and resolution of your story.

  5. Identifying Plot Holes:

    While not perfect, ChatGPT can help identify inconsistencies. Prompt: "Read this plot outline [insert your outline]. Can you identify any potential plot holes or inconsistencies?"

D. Dialogue Writing

Writing engaging and authentic dialogue is a crucial skill for screenwriters. While ChatGPT can generate dialogue, it often requires significant refinement.

  1. Generating Dialogue for Specific Scenes:

    Prompt: "Write a dialogue scene between two characters arguing about whether to trust a stranger."

    Specify the characters' personalities and motivations to get more relevant dialogue.

  2. Creating Dialogue That Reflects Character Voice:

    Prompt: "Write a line of dialogue for a character who is sarcastic and cynical."

    This can help you establish the character's voice and tone.

  3. Varying Dialogue Styles:

    Experiment with prompts that specify different dialogue styles. For example, Prompt: "Write a scene with snappy, fast-paced dialogue between two journalists." Or, Prompt: "Write a scene with slow, deliberate dialogue between two elderly neighbors."

  4. Refining Existing Dialogue:

    Prompt: "Rewrite the following dialogue to make it sound more natural and realistic: [insert dialogue]."

    ChatGPT can help you improve the flow and authenticity of your dialogue.

  5. Generating Subtext:

    This is a more advanced technique, but you can try prompting ChatGPT to suggest subtextual meanings. Prompt: "In this scene [describe the scene], what subtext could be present between the characters?"

E. Scene Description

Creating vivid and evocative scene descriptions is essential for immersing the audience in your story. ChatGPT can help you craft compelling descriptions of settings and actions.

  1. Describing Settings:

    Prompt: "Describe a dark and rainy alleyway in a crime-ridden city."

    Specify the atmosphere, details, and sensory details you want to convey.

  2. Describing Actions:

    Prompt: "Describe a character nervously pacing back and forth while waiting for important news."

    Focus on the character's physical movements, facial expressions, and body language.

  3. Setting the Mood:

    Use descriptive words that set the tone. For example, Prompt: "Describe a sun-drenched beach scene, emphasizing the feeling of tranquility and escape." Or, Prompt: "Describe the interior of an abandoned hospital, emphasizing the feeling of decay and unease."

  4. Integrating Action and Description:

    Prompt: "Write a scene description of a character entering a room and discovering a shocking secret."

    Combine the description of the setting with the character's actions and reactions.

F. World-Building (Genre-Specific)

For genres like fantasy and science fiction, creating a believable and consistent world is crucial. ChatGPT can assist in developing the rules, history, and culture of your world.

  1. Creating Fictional Histories:

    Prompt: "Create a brief history of a fictional kingdom in a fantasy world."

    Specify the key events, rulers, and conflicts that shaped the kingdom.

  2. Developing Unique Cultures:

    Prompt: "Describe the customs and traditions of a futuristic society that lives on a space station."

    Consider the society's values, beliefs, and social structures.

  3. Defining Magic Systems (Fantasy):

    Prompt: "Describe a unique magic system based on the manipulation of emotions."

    Outline the rules, limitations, and consequences of using the magic.

  4. Designing Technologies (Science Fiction):

    Prompt: "Describe a futuristic technology that allows people to travel through time."

    Explain how the technology works, its potential benefits, and its potential risks.

  5. Generating Creature Concepts:

    Prompt: "Describe a unique alien creature adapted to living in a high-gravity environment."

G. Research and Information Gathering

ChatGPT can quickly gather information on specific topics relevant to your screenplay. However, always verify its accuracy.

  1. Researching Historical Events:

    Prompt: "What were the key events that led to the Cold War?"

  2. Gathering Information on Specific Professions:

    Prompt: "What are the daily responsibilities of a forensic scientist?"

  3. Understanding Scientific Concepts:

    Prompt: "Explain the concept of quantum entanglement in simple terms."

  4. Exploring Different Cultures:

    Prompt: "What are some common customs in Japanese culture?"

  5. Finding Locations:

    You can use ChatGPT to brainstorm unique locations, but always do further research. Prompt: "Suggest 5 unique locations for a scene where two spies are meeting in secret."

H. Rewriting and Editing

ChatGPT can help you identify areas for improvement and suggest alternative phrasing.

  1. Identifying Weak Dialogue:

    Prompt: "Analyze the following dialogue for areas that sound unnatural or repetitive: [insert dialogue]."

  2. Suggesting Alternative Phrasing:

    Prompt: "Suggest alternative ways to phrase the following sentence: [insert sentence]."

  3. Improving Scene Flow:

    Prompt: "Analyze the following scene for pacing and suggest ways to improve its flow: [insert scene]."

  4. Identifying Redundancy:

    Prompt: "Analyze this scene for any redundant information or descriptions."

  5. Checking for Tone and Consistency:

    Prompt: "Does the tone of this scene align with the overall tone of the screenplay? [Insert Scene]." You can also prompt it to check for consistency in character voice and plot details.

III. Best Practices for Using ChatGPT in Screenplay Writing

To maximize the benefits of ChatGPT and minimize its limitations, follow these best practices:

  • Be Specific and Detailed in Your Prompts: The more information you provide, the more relevant and useful the output will be.
  • Iterate and Refine: Don't accept the first output as the final version. Use ChatGPT as a starting point and refine its suggestions to fit your vision.
  • Use ChatGPT as a Collaborative Partner, Not a Replacement: Your own creativity and judgment are essential for creating a compelling screenplay.
  • Verify Information: Always double-check the accuracy of any information generated by ChatGPT.
  • Avoid Plagiarism: Ensure you are not copying content verbatim from ChatGPT without attribution. Use its output as inspiration, not as a direct replacement for your own writing.
  • Maintain Control of Your Story: Don't let ChatGPT dictate the direction of your screenplay. Stay true to your vision and use ChatGPT to enhance, not replace, your own storytelling abilities.
  • Experiment with Different Prompts: Try different phrasing and approaches to see what generates the best results.
  • Focus on Specific Tasks: ChatGPT is often more effective when used for specific tasks, such as generating ideas for a particular scene or developing a character's backstory.
  • Use Multiple AI Tools: Consider supplementing ChatGPT with other AI tools that specialize in different aspects of screenwriting, such as storyboarding or script formatting.
  • Consider the Ethical Implications: Be mindful of the ethical implications of using AI in screenwriting, such as the potential impact on human writers and the issue of copyright.

IV. Example Prompts and Scenarios

Here are some more detailed examples of how you can use ChatGPT for specific screenplay writing tasks:

A. Developing a Protagonist

Scenario: You need to develop a compelling protagonist for your action screenplay.

Prompts:

    Prompt 1: "Describe a protagonist who is a former special forces soldier struggling with PTSD. Include details about their past, their skills, and their current emotional state."

    Prompt 2: "What are the possible motivations for a protagonist who is forced to return to a life of violence after trying to leave it behind?"

    Prompt 3: "Write a short monologue for the protagonist expressing their inner conflict about their past actions."

    Prompt 4: "Outline a character arc for the protagonist, showing how they overcome their PTSD and find redemption."
    

B. Generating a Plot Twist

Scenario: You need a compelling plot twist for your mystery thriller.

Prompts:

    Prompt 1: "Generate 5 plot twists for a mystery thriller about a detective investigating a series of seemingly unrelated murders."

    Prompt 2: "Suggest a plot twist that reveals the detective is actually the killer."

    Prompt 3: "Suggest a plot twist that reveals the victim is still alive."

    Prompt 4: "Suggest a plot twist that involves a secret organization manipulating events behind the scenes."

    Prompt 5: "Refine the plot twist that reveals the detective is the killer. What are the motivations, and how could this be subtly foreshadowed earlier in the screenplay?"
    

C. Writing a Dialogue Scene

Scenario: You need to write a dialogue scene between two characters who are in conflict.

Prompts:

    Prompt 1: "Write a dialogue scene between two siblings arguing about the inheritance of their family's estate. One sibling is greedy and manipulative, while the other is principled and fair."

    Prompt 2: "Incorporate subtext into the dialogue scene, where the true feelings of the characters are not explicitly stated but implied through their words and actions."

    Prompt 3: "Write the same dialogue scene from the perspective of each character, highlighting their individual motivations and perceptions."

    Prompt 4: "Rewrite the dialogue scene to make it more dramatic and intense, using shorter sentences and more emotionally charged language."

    Prompt 5: "After reviewing the scene, suggest three ways to make the dialogue more realistic and less 'on the nose'."
    

V. The Future of AI in Screenplay Writing

AI is rapidly evolving, and its role in screenplay writing is likely to become even more significant in the future. We can anticipate:

  • More Sophisticated AI Models: Future AI models will likely be able to generate more nuanced and sophisticated dialogue, character development, and plot structures.
  • Integration with Screenwriting Software: AI tools will likely be integrated directly into screenwriting software, providing real-time assistance and feedback.
  • Personalized AI Assistance: AI tools may be able to learn your individual writing style and preferences, providing personalized suggestions and feedback.
  • AI-Generated Storyboards and Visualizations: AI may be able to generate storyboards and visualizations based on your screenplay, helping you visualize your story and communicate your vision to others.
  • Ethical Considerations Will Become More Prominent: As AI becomes more powerful, ethical considerations surrounding its use in screenwriting will become even more important. Issues such as copyright, plagiarism, and the impact on human writers will need to be carefully addressed.

VI. Conclusion

ChatGPT is a powerful tool that can significantly enhance the screenwriting process when used effectively. By understanding its capabilities and limitations, following best practices, and using it as a collaborative partner, you can leverage ChatGPT to generate ideas, develop characters, structure your story, and write compelling dialogue and scene descriptions. While AI will likely play an increasingly important role in screenwriting in the future, it's important to remember that human creativity and judgment remain essential for creating truly compelling and original screenplays. Embrace AI as a tool, but always stay true to your own vision and storytelling abilities.
